Summary of Changes

This pull request focuses on cleaning up and standardizing the .pre-commit-config.yaml file. The changes primarily involve updating the names and adding descriptions to the hooks used by pre-commit. This aims to improve the readability and maintainability of the configuration file, making it easier for developers to understand the purpose of each hook.

Highlights

  • Hook Name Standardization: The names of several hooks have been updated to follow a more consistent run <hook-name> naming convention.
  • Hook Descriptions: Descriptions have been added to each hook to clarify its purpose.

Changelog

  • .pre-commit-config.yaml
    • Updated hook names to follow the run <hook-name> convention (e.g., detect hardcoded secrets to run gitleaks).
    • Added descriptions to each hook to explain its functionality (e.g., added 'check your identity' description to the identity hook).
    • Minor grammatical change to the markdownlint description, changing 'Checks' to 'checks'.

Invoking Gemini

You can request assistance from Gemini at any point in your pull request via creating an issue comment (i.e. comment on the pull request page) using either /gemini <command> or @gemini-code-assist <command>. Below is a summary of the supported commands.

Feature Command Description
Code Review /gemini review Performs a code review for the current pull request in its current state.
Pull Request Summary /gemini summary Provides a summary of the current pull request in its current state.
Comment @gemini-code-assist Responds in comments when explicitly tagged, both in issue comments and review comments.
Help /gemini help Displays a list of available commands.

Customization

To customize Gemini Code Assist for GitHub experience, repository maintainers can create a configuration file and/or provide a custom code review style guide (such as PEP-8 for Python) by creating and adding files to a .gemini/ folder in the base of the repository. What is the purpose of a pre-commit hook?

Click here for the answer
Pre-commit hooks are scripts that run automatically before each commit. They are used to identify and fix issues before code review.
